how could you use 1/8 cup measuring cup to measure the light corn syrup 9/12)
Final answer:
To measure 9/12 or 3/4 of a cup of syrup using a 1/8 cup, fill and level-off the 1/8 cup measuring cup six times. This uses basic fraction multiplication and measurement skills appropriate for middle school mathematics.
Explanation:
To measure light corn syrup using a 1/8 cup measuring cup, you first need to understand the fraction you're working with, which is 9/12 of a cup. Simplifying this fraction gives you 3/4 of a cup (since 9/12 reduces to 3/4 by dividing both the numerator and denominator by 3). Now, since there are 8 portions of 1/8 in a full cup, you need 6 portions of 1/8 (because 3/4 equals 6/8) to measure out 3/4 of a cup of light corn syrup.
To do this, you'll fill the 1/8 cup measuring cup six times and add each portion to your mixture to reach the desired amount of 9/12 or 3/4 of a cup of syrup. This is a simple example of using measurements and fractions to achieve the correct proportions in a recipe or any culinary preparation.
Two runners are to race one lap on a circular track, the radius to the inside circle is 50m.the radius on the outside lane is 51m. How much of a head start should the runner on the outside get?
Tmuch of a head start should the runner on the outside get would be = 2πm.
How to calculate the length of head start for the runner outside?
To calculate the length of head start for the runner outside against the inside runner, the following steps should be taken as follows:
The formula for circumferential of circle = 2πr
Circumference of inner circle;
= 2× π×50
= 100π
Circumference of outer circle;
= 2×π×51
= 102π
The length of head start for the runner outside = 102π-100π = 2πm

Choose the correct simplification of the expression (−2x + 4y)(3x − 7y). −6x2 − 2xy − 28y2 6x2 + 26xy − 28y2 −6x2 + 26xy + 28y2 −6x2 + 26xy − 28y2
Answer:
[tex] - 6 {x}^{2} + 26xy - 28 {y}^{2} [/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
The given expresion is:
(−2x + 4y)(3x − 7y)
We expand using the distributive property: (a+b)(c+d)=a(c+d)+b(c+d)
We apply this property to get:
[tex]( - 2x + 4y)(3x - 7y) = - 2x \times(3x - 7y) + 4y(3x - 7y)[/tex]
We expand further to obtain:
[tex] - 6 {x}^{2} + 14xy + 12xy - 28 {y}^{2} [/tex]
[tex] - 6 {x}^{2} + 26xy - 28{y}^{2} [/tex]
